Since 1894, Chicago Commons has operated in come of the city's most under-resourced neighborhoods. Today, we are located in the neighborhoods of Humboldt Park, Pilsen, Back of the Yards, and Bronzeville, and offer senior care throughout metro Chicago. Our programs work together to create opportunities and move children and families toward educational success, economic security, and health and well-being.
Our services ensure that children, families and seniors GO further.
Early Childhood Education: Through four early education centers, we ensure that children are prepared for kindergarten ready to learn.
Family Hub: While their children are being educated and cared for, parents and families can receive comprehensive educational and support services through our Family Hub program.
Senior Care: We provide in-home care and adult day services, enabling seniors to stay in their homes while their family members work or go to school.
